From Webster's Revised Unabridged Dictionary (1913) (web1913)

Freshly \Fresh"ly\, adv.
In a fresh manner; vigorously; newly, recently; brightly;
briskly; coolly; as, freshly gathered; freshly painted; the
wind blows freshly.

Looks he as freshly as he did? --Shak.

From WordNet (r) 1.7 (wn)

freshly
adv 1: very recently; "they are newly married"; "newly raised
objections"; "a newly arranged hairdo"; "grass new
washed by the rain"; "a freshly cleaned floor"; "we
are fresh out of tomatoes" [syn: {recently}, {newly},
{fresh}, {new}]
2: in an impudent or impertinent manner; "a lean, swarthy
fellow was peering through the window, grinning
impudently" [syn: {impertinently}, {saucily}, {pertly}, {impudently}]
